— THEN, AND N O W
The meat peddler of the old days, who killed his o w i
live stock and then sold the meat from the tail of a
cart, is gone from our larger towns and cities. He was
a pioneer and did good service but he couldn’t keep up
with his job. Crude methods have given way to new
ideas in sanitation and distribution.
